Away Supporters' Facilities:
Under normal circumstances visiting supporters will be housed in our North Stand which was opened in 1999 and provides a 'behind the goals' view. The initial allocation to visiting clubs will be 2000 seats although it may be possible to increase this figure by prior arrangement. North Stand visitors turnstiles are numbered 42 - 51 inclusive and are normally open during the ninety minute period before kick-off.

Under normal circumstances admission will be by payment at the turnstiles only - tickets will only be available in advance where a large away following is expected.

Barnsley is pleased to welcome visiting supporters who are confined to wheelchairs. These supporters will be accommodated on a platform area within the main body of visiting supporters in our North Stand. We can initially provide spaces for up to nine wheelchair bound supporters although this figure may be increased if required. A special disabled entrance, number 52, which is adjacent to the North Stand turnstiles is available to admit disabled supporters to their viewing area. Wheelchair bound supporters and carers must arrive with pre-purchased tickets - please contact Jon Morley, Box Office Supervisor, on boxoffice@barnsleyfc.co.uk or on 01226 211211.

We are also able to provide commentary for blind supporters in the disabled section of our Corner Stand. Anyone requiring blind facilities should contact their own club's Box Office in the first instance. How To Get There:
By Road:
All visiting supporters travelling by road should approach the Oakwell Stadium from junction 37 of the M1 motorway. From this point vehicles should follow the black/white 'Barnsley Football Club' and brown/white 'Football Ground' signs. These signs lead directly to our visitors car park.

By Rail:
The nearest railway station is Barnsley which is located in the town centre and is only a five minute walk from the stadium.

Parking:
A large visitors car/coach park is situated adjacent to the visitors entrances. It can accommodate about five hundred vehicles and a small parking charge involved. Prices for the 2003/2004 season will be determined shortly. All visiting supporters, including the disabled, who are travelling by road should use this car park.
